Immunology is the 795th most popular major in the country with 155 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across North Carolina, there were 4 immunology gra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 2 immunology graduates with average earnings and debt of $72,103 and $114,434 respectively.

Duke University

Durham, North Carolina
#1 in overall quality

Out of the 1 schools in the Best Value Immunology Schools for a Doctorate in North Carolina that were part of this year’s ranking, Duke University landed the #1 spot on the list. Durham, North Carolina is the setting for this fairly large institution of higher learning. The private not-for-profit school handed out doctorate’s immunology degrees to 2 students in 2019-2020.

Duke also made our “Best Immunology Doctor’s Degree Schools in North Carolina” list, coming in at #1. Average graduate tuition and fees at Duke University are $59,140,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
